Modular transportable nuclear generator
The present invention relates generally to electric power and process heat generation using a modular, compact, transportable, hardened nuclear generator rapidly deployable and retrievable, comprising power conversion and electric generation equipment fully integrated within a single pressure vessel housing a nuclear core. The resulting transportable nuclear generator does not require costly site-preparation, and can be transported fully operational. The transportable nuclear generator requires an emergency evacuation area substantially reduced with respect to other nuclear generators as it may be configured for operation with a melt-proof conductive ceramic core which allows decay heat removal even under total loss of coolant scenarios.
Steam supply system and CO2 recovery unit including the same
A steam supply system that can reheat CO.sub.2 absorbing liquid without lowering performance of a reboiler by decompressing a condensed water drum is provided. This system includes a reboiler that raises the temperature of absorbing liquid contacted with exhaust gas discharged from a boiler to absorb CO.sub.2 in the exhaust gas and heated to eliminate CO.sub.2. The reboiler includes a heat exchanger tube to which steam for heating is supplied and a condensed water drum that recovers condensed water of the steam introduced from the heat exchanger tube as steam drain, and the condensed water drum is provided with decompression unit that lowers pressure in the condensed water drum.
System and method for simultaneous multi-tube inspection of vertical tube bundles
A multi-tube inspection system with a reel having a plurality of cameras is placed in the upper header. Each camera is attached to its own lead line and has a light source. An inspector, located in the upper header, aligns each camera with a tube and then operates the reel to simultaneously lower the cameras through their respective tube. As the cameras pass through the tubes, they capture a video image of the interior length of the tube. The video image is stored and relayed to a control center where additional inspectors can review the video image of the interior of the tube. Each video is identified and tied back to the tube in a data base. If a defect is identified, the tube can be taken out of service (blocked off) or scheduled for cleaning. Once cleaned, the tube is then reinspected.

Method and system for improving boiler effectiveness
A method for improving effectiveness of a steam generator system includes providing a steam generator system including a steam generator vessel, an air supply system and an air preheater. The air supply system is in communication with the steam generator vessel through the air preheater and the steam generator vessel is in communication with the air preheater. The air supply system provides a first amount of air to the air preheater. At least a portion of the first amount of air is provided to the steam generator vessel. A flue gas mixture is discharged from the steam generator vessel. At least a portion of the flue gas mixture flows into the air preheater. SO.sub.3 in the flue gas mixture is mitigated before the flue gas mixture enters the air preheater.

FLEXIBLE LANCE FOR MACHINING OR INSPECTING A TUBESHEET OF A BOILER
The invention relates to a flexible lance for machining or inspecting a tubesheet of a boiler, having a first strip made of a flexible, metallic material and a second strip made of a flexible, metallic material, wherein the second strip is arranged on the first strip in the longitudinal direction, and wherein at least the second strip has a shaped portion extending in the longitudinal direction for receiving a supply line for a machining or inspection head arranged at the free end of the flexible lance, and wherein the first strip is connected to the second strip such that an open side of the shaped portion is covered by the first strip so as to form a guide channel, and wherein at least one edge region of the flexible lance, extending in the longitudinal direction, is formed only by the first strip or the second strip.
Hand-Held Steam Cleaning Apparatus
A hand-held steam cleaning apparatus including: a housing, provided with a handle; a steam generating unit, including a heating body and configured to heat water and vaporize the water into steam; a steam nozzle, configured to output the steam; and a water supply device, including a water tank and pump configured to pump the water in the water tank into the steam generating unit. The cleaning apparatus is powered by a battery pack. The weight of the cleaning apparatus is not greater than 2 kg when the housing is fitted with the battery pack and the water tank is fully loaded; the capacity of the battery pack is in the range of 36-144 Wh. The steam flow capacity is in the range of 3-12 g/min; and the continuous work time is not less than 2 min.
Solid metallic component and method for producing same
The invention relates in particular to a solid metallic component. This component (1) is particularly notable in that it comprises a core (5) and an external shell (3) which surrounds said core (5) in all directions, this core (5) and this shell (3) being made of different grades of steel, the steel of said core (5) having martensite and bainite critical cooling rates lower than those of the steel or steels of said shell (3).
Power conversion system
A power conversion system for converting thermal energy from a heat source to electricity is provided. The system includes a chamber including an inner shroud having an inlet and an outlet and defining an internal passageway between the inlet and the outlet through which a working fluid passes. The chamber also includes an outer shroud substantially surrounding the inner shroud. The chamber includes a source heat exchanger disposed in the internal passageway, the source heat exchanger being configured to receive a heat transmitting element associated with the heat source external to the chamber, and to transfer heat energy from the heat transmitting element to the working fluid. The system also includes a compressor disposed adjacent the inlet of the inner shroud and configured to transfer energy from the compressor to the working fluid, and an expander disposed adjacent the outlet of the inner shroud.
